Shot on 8mm film in 1960, this vintage home movie captures a construction crew pouring concrete steps at a residential home in Wauconda, Illinois. Three men in work clothes—overalls, plaid shirts, and caps—work together to smooth the wet cement. The scene shows the raw, hands-on process of building, with wooden forms and tools visible. Sunlight illuminates the gray concrete and weathered siding, creating a nostalgic, authentic snapshot of mid-century American craftsmanship. The grainy, slightly faded quality of the Super 8 footage enhances its archival charm.
